What is a Jackpot Aggregator?
Traditionally, progressive jackpots were tied to a single game (standalone) or a network of games provided by a single software application developer (wide-area network prizes). For circumstances, a player spinning a specific slot device contributed to a reward swimming pool that just grew through the actions of players playing that precise game or designer's suite of titles.
A prize aggregator, nevertheless, is an advanced software option that pools bets throughout several games, various software application companies, and sometimes even across multiple casino platforms.
By connecting diverse games into a single, huge reward pool, aggregators can skyrocket jackpot totals to unprecedented heights in record time. Believe of it as a monetary super-highway that funnels micro-contributions from thousands of various fruit machine into one enormous, centralized vault.
How Does a Jackpot Aggregator Work?
To comprehend the magic behind the aggregation, it helps to look at the mechanics. While proprietary software application varies by tech supplier, the core process usually follows these steps:
- Integration: The aggregator software application integrates with numerous game suppliers and casino platforms through robust APIs (Application Programming Interfaces).
- Contribution: A micro-percentage of every real-money wager put on getting involved video games is siphoned off and included to the central prize swimming pool.
- Tiering: Many aggregators use a multi-tiered prize system (e.g., Mini, Minor, Major, Mega) to guarantee players experience regular, smaller wins along with the elusive grand prize.
- Triggering: The prize can be triggered arbitrarily, through a particular bonus offer round, or via a must-drop system (where the prize is guaranteed to pay out before reaching a certain financial threshold or time frame).
- Payout: Once won, the central pool resets to a fixed seed quantity, and the build-up cycle begins once again.

Key Challenges and Considerations
While the advantages are clear, the application of prize aggregators is not without hurdles.
- Regulatory Compliance: Because aggregators typically span numerous jurisdictions, they should adhere to differing local gaming laws, licensing requirements, and tax responsibilities.
- Technical Complexity: Integrating multiple APIs from different service providers while guaranteeing real-time synchronization of the prize meter requires bulletproof innovation.
- Seed Funding: Someone must fund the initial starting amount (the seed) when a prize is won. Developing who covers this cost needs clear agreements between the aggregator, the platform, and the game company.
